      In the Korean Professional Football League, a much - anticipated match sees Fuchuan FC hosting Jeju SK at home. Looking at the overall season statistics, the two teams have strikingly similar records. Fuchuan FC has a 40% win rate, a 30% draw rate, and a 30% loss rate in all their games. They've scored 14 goals, conceded 11, with a goal difference of 3. Their average goals per game are 1.4, average corner kicks reach 3.5, and the average number of yellow cards per game is 2.1. Jeju SK also has a 40% win rate, with 30% draws and 30% losses. They've scored 15 goals and conceded 11, resulting in a goal difference of 4. Their average goals per game are 1.5, and they have an impressively high average of 4.09 corner kicks per game, while their average yellow cards per game are also 2.1. This similarity in performance makes it difficult to predict the outcome of the match, and it will likely be a closely - contested battle.       In the K - League, several matches are worth analyzing. Let's focus on FC Bucheon. Currently sitting in the 10th position in the league, they've played 28 rounds with 7 wins, 10 draws, and 11 losses, accumulating 31 points. They've scored 29 goals and conceded 36. Their home record is rather weak. In 15 home games, they've only managed 3 wins, 6 draws, and 6 losses. They've conceded as many as 22 goals at home, showing a lack of defensive stability. A notable example is their home - game 0 - 5 thrashing by Daejeon Citizen. In their last game, they lost 1 - 2 away to Incheon United. Although they can create shooting opportunities, their defense often makes mistakes in the second half of the game. The team employs a 3 - 4 - 3 formation, relying mainly on flanking attacks. However, their efficiency in breaking down opponents' defenses in positional play is mediocre.
